2. Server Components and Hybrid Rendering
React Server Components and Next.js App Router have matured significantly. The ability to seamlessly mix server-side and client-side rendering in the same application is now the standard approach for building performant web applications.
Benefits:
- Reduced JavaScript bundle sizes (up to 80% smaller)
- Improved initial page load times
- Better SEO out of the box
- Simplified data fetching patterns
Frameworks like Next.js 15+, Remix, and SvelteKit are leading this revolution, making it easier than ever to build fast, SEO-friendly applications.
3. Edge Computing Goes Mainstream
Edge computing has transitioned from experimental to essential. Deploying code closer to users through edge networks like Cloudflare Workers, Vercel Edge Functions, and AWS Lambda@Edge is now standard practice for high-performance applications.
Real-world impact: Applications deployed on edge networks see 50-70% reduction in latency for global users, dramatically improving user experience across geographies.
4. WebAssembly for Performance-Critical Features
WebAssembly (Wasm) is no longer just for games and video editing. In 2026, it's being used for:
- Complex data processing and analytics
- Real-time image and video manipulation
- Cryptography and security operations
- Scientific computing in the browser
Languages like Rust, Go, and C++ are being compiled to Wasm, bringing near-native performance to web applications. This enables use cases that were previously impossible in the browser.
5. Progressive Web Apps (PWAs) 2.0
PWAs have evolved significantly with new capabilities that blur the line between web and native apps:
- Advanced offline functionality: Full app experiences without internet
- File system access: Direct file manipulation like native apps
- Background sync: Seamless data synchronization
- Push notifications: Now supported across all major browsers
- App shortcuts: Quick actions from home screen
Major companies are choosing PWAs over native apps for their cross-platform strategy, reducing development costs by 60% while maintaining excellent user experiences.

7. Micro-Frontends Architecture
Large organizations are adopting micro-frontends to enable independent team workflows and technology flexibility. This architectural pattern allows different parts of a web application to be developed, deployed, and scaled independently.
Key advantages:
- Teams can work autonomously with their own tech stacks
- Faster deployment cycles for individual features
- Better fault isolation—one module's failure doesn't crash the entire app
- Easier to scale development teams
Tools like Module Federation (Webpack 5), Single-SPA, and Nx are making micro-frontends more accessible to teams of all sizes.
8. Green Web Development
Sustainability is now a core consideration in web development. Developers are optimizing for energy efficiency alongside performance:
- Carbon-aware hosting: Choosing data centers powered by renewable energy
- Efficient code: Minimizing CPU cycles and network requests
- Lazy loading everything: Loading resources only when needed
- Image optimization: Using modern formats like AVIF and WebP
- Dark mode: Reducing energy consumption on OLED screens
Tools like Website Carbon Calculator and EcoGrader help measure and improve the environmental impact of websites.
9. Advanced Animation and Interaction
Web animations have reached new heights with improved browser APIs and libraries:
- View Transitions API: Smooth page transitions without JavaScript frameworks
- Scroll-driven animations: Native browser support for scroll-based effects
- Motion One: Lightweight, performant animation library
- Three.js and WebGL: 3D experiences becoming mainstream
These technologies enable rich, app-like experiences while maintaining excellent performance and accessibility.
10. Enhanced Security Practices
Security is more critical than ever, with new standards and practices becoming mandatory:
- Zero Trust Architecture: Never trust, always verify
- Content Security Policy (CSP): Strict CSP is now standard
- Subresource Integrity (SRI): Verifying third-party resources
- HTTPS everywhere: HTTP is effectively deprecated
- Secure authentication: Passkeys and WebAuthn replacing passwords
Frameworks are building security best practices by default, making it easier to build secure applications without being a security expert.

Are these trends suitable for small projects?
Many of these trends, like TypeScript and server components, benefit projects of all sizes. However, micro-frontends and edge computing are typically more valuable for larger, more complex applications.
